Protect Your IPTV with a Tunnel

Increasingly, subscribers are realizing the value of security when enjoying their IPTV. Your signal can be vulnerable, exposing your online activity. A secure tunnel acts as a barrier, masking your traffic and routing it through a secure server. This helps avoid geo-restrictions, stop ISP monitoring, and conceal your online identity from prying entities. It’s a relatively simple process to take and a vital layer of security for any serious content consumer. Consider a trusted provider to ensure best performance and a truly secure experience.

Establishing a Virtual Private Network Internet Protocol Television

Getting your VPN and IPTV working together can seem intimidating at first, but it's actually fairly easy with a small guidance. This walkthrough will offer a step-by-step approach to verify a stable connection. First, select a reputable Secured Tunnel provider and subscribe to their offering. Next, download and install the Secured Tunnel application on your device – whether it's a mobile device, desktop, or router. Once that, adjust the Secured Tunnel settings to link to a server area that is best for your Internet Protocol Television provider’s content. Then, open your Internet Protocol Television application and access your favorite programs. Remember to consistently check your VPN is active before launching your Streaming Service.
